Wiktionary
PARDONER, noun. One who pardons.
PARDONER, noun. (historical) In medieval Catholicism, a person licensed to grant papal pardons or indulgences.
Dictionary definition
PARDONER, noun. A person who pardons or forgives or excuses a fault or offense.
PARDONER, noun. A medieval cleric who raised money for the church by selling papal indulgences.
